Later that day was the quarterly Primary activity. The whole thing was focused on getting to know President Monson. Here is a picture of our life-sized shoots and ladders game. The kids would roll a big die and then learn something about Pres. Monson on each square they landed on. There was a bridge and a slide and a "log cabin" to represent Pres. Monson's cabin in Provo Canyon. On one square they had to shoot a basket (because he loves basketball) and at the end they had to be able to answer a question about him to get through the Berlin Wall (you know, because he helped get a temple built in the then East Germany). I think the kids enjoyed this for the most part, though we had one really wild group (to put it kindly).



We had a prophet relay. They had to put on a jacket, tie, pants and shoes then dribble the ball down, shoot a basket, then come back and undress for the next kid in line. Steve wasn't happy that I used his church shoes for this!












I didn't get pictures of the other two stations--one was about how he visited widows who made him cakes every year for Christmas (they got to decorate and eat a cupcake), and the other was a Boy Scout obstacle course created by our Bear leader--I heard it was really fun but was in the shoots and ladders room the whole time. They tied knots, raced pinewood derby cars, and I don't know what else, though it sounded creative! Overall I think it was fun, but I'm glad it's over!
